Role Overview
As an Intermediate Mechanical Engineer, you will join the Building Services team, playing a key role in the design and delivery of projects, with a strong emphasis on healthcare schemes.
Responsibilities
- Designing mechanical building services systems including HVAC and public health
- Producing detailed calculations, specifications, and technical reports
- Working within a multidisciplinary team using BIM processes
- Supporting the delivery of healthcare projects in line with industry standards
- Attending meetings with clients, stakeholders, and project teams
- Supporting senior engineers and contributing to junior team development
- Assisting in the delivery of sustainable and energy‑efficient design solutions
Qualifications
- A degree in Mechanical or Building Services Engineering (or equivalent)
- Around 3‑6 years' experience within a building services consultancy
- Experience of, or a strong interest in, healthcare sector projects
- Knowledge of UK Building Regulations and CIBSE guidance
- Familiarity with HTM/HBN standards (desirable)
- Experience using industry software such as IES, Hevacomp, or Revit/BIM tools
- A proactive approach with strong communication and teamwork skills
- Motivation to work towards professional accreditation (IEng/CEng)
